  2. Curt - Today at 12:19
  3. Briefly, what is your role within GOTG currently, and what does it involve?
  4. (opsec stuff obv not obliged to talk about)
  5. RiotRick - Today at 12:29
  6. I prefer to call us Dead Coalition, as a couple months ago we've been told we're dead by now.
  7. I had the remindme bot send notifications already that it's past due.
  8. But I'm an AU FC for Dead Coalition, and also lead one of the alliances - SLYCE.
  9. Curt - Today at 12:34
  10. and how do you feel your coalition is doing right now?
  11. In terms of winning/losing, and territorial losses/expansion
  12. RiotRick - Today at 12:36
  13. Can you re-phrase the question?
  14. How do I feel about our core space of Branch, Dek, Tenal, and Fade?
  15. Curt - Today at 12:38
  16. Sorry. Are you able to give some insight on the current war against the Goon SiGs, and Init? how successful/unsuccessful do you think you guys have been so far?
  17. RiotRick - Today at 12:38
  18. I feel anything pass 4 regions is a stretch, and with Horde leaving, we invited many orgs to kinda fight for space in PB.
  19. Goons have pinged for support from Delve in a few fights now, and we see INIT and TNT attempting to fully deploy to help.
  20. I think it speaks well of their challenges.
  21. You can always separate the propaganda with reality, we can just open dotlan to see if there's been any ihub destroyed in Dek, Branch, Tenal, or heck even Fade.
  22. Or even zkb, if there's been any core structures destroyed in Dead Coalition's space.

  101. Are you able to comment on MOA's departure?
  102. RiotRick - Today at 13:07
  103. Yeah absolutely.
  104. They're great bros, Gen Eve, their alliance leader can't commit to the game right now so they're putting the corps out and they're joining the rest of Dead Co and Co2. They'll be back when he's ready.
  105. Curt - Today at 13:11
  106. Earlier you said that TNT and Init deploying to assist Goon SiGs was indicative of the challenge that they were facing fighting you guys. Do you feel that CO2 doing the same for your coalition shows the same thing?
  107. RiotRick - Today at 13:12
  108. Good question, Horde leaving Fade and Pure Blind is certainly a big vacuum.
  109. We have a lot of smaller alliances take up space in Pure Blind, and the chaos being driven there for the most part is good content for the region.
  110. For Fade, I think Co2's going to do well in Horde's previous area.
  111. Anyone not being honest that Horde left a large vacuum in areas that they controlled is lying to ya.
  112. Curt - Today at 13:16
  113. Really? How reliant on Horde were you?
  114. RiotRick - Today at 13:19
  115. Dead Co without renter numbers, is a relatively small size coalition. There is no way in the world we'd be able to control what 15k Hordelings managed. Even Goons with such a large number, won't dare to take up all the sov in Querious. It makes better sense to consolidate in 1-2 regions.
  116. Curt - Today at 13:23
  117. You're consolidating?
  118. RiotRick - Today at 13:24
  119. Yep, Dead Co started with Branch, Dek, Tenal sov, and a little bit of Fade, but we're not going to maintain any holdings in former PH space.
  120. Curt - Today at 13:25
  121. Will you be giving the two regions you're not using up, then?
  122. RiotRick - Today at 13:26
  123. PB? If you look at the map there's a few alliances like French Connection and Banderlogs that have taken root.
  124. Curt - Today at 13:27
  125. Sorry. Let me rephrase. In what way does it make sense to consolidate to 1-2 regions? Is that at an alliance or coalition level?
  126. RiotRick - Today at 13:28
  127. In the same way Goons consolidate in Delve, Fountain, and bits of Querious, our position -- old, not new --- is to maintain Branch, Dek, Tenal, and a little Fade.
  128. We definitely invite smaller alliances to work with us to have content space in Pure Blind. Old PH space in Fade, as you already know, is being given to Co2.
  129. The idea to maintain a smaller footprint and grow, like Goons have initially after losing Deklein, they setup and consolidated in 1-2 regions.
  130. It's a sound strategy.
